OpenAI has released a preview of its latest model, OpenAI o1, finally confirming the existence of the rumoured 'Strawberry'.

o1-preview is the first in a new family of artificial intelligence models that OpenAI is developing, according to the company's press release.

The new model is designed to "spend more time thinking before they respond," similar to human thought processing and rationalisation. It is capable of performing at the same levels as PhD students, on challenging benchmark tests in physics, chemistry and biology, OpenAI said.

For example, GPT-4o can solve 13% of International Mathematics Olympiad problems correctly, while o1-preview can solve 83%.

OpenAI's newest model caters to those working in scientific fields like math, coding, and physics. If true, and if o1 can truly enhance the productivity of such fields, it can prove to be a game changer for researchers across disciplines.

In addition to o1, the company is also releasing the o1-mini model. The smaller version is "faster, cheaper reasoning model that is particularly effective at coding". It is also 80% cheaper than the o1-preview model that has currently been released.

Rollout

Starting Thursday night, o1-preview became available for ChatGPT Plus and Team users. The smaller o1-mini model will be available in the ChatGPT model picking interface. There is currently a weekly rate limit, with o1 preview getting 30 messages, while o1 mini gets 50.

It's worth pointing out that the current version that is available to users is just a preview of the full blown model that is currently still in development.

ChatGPT Enterprise and Edu users will see the new model roll out to their accounts in the coming week. While OpenAI intends to make o1-mini free to all ChatGPT Free tier users, like it has with earlier models, it hasn't provided a release date yet.

Hefty Developer Pricing

The advanced reasoning skills from o1-preview come with a hefty price tag for developers. In the API, the o1-preview costs about $15 per 1 million input tokens and $60 per 1 million output tokens, according to The Verge. For context, GPT-4o costs $5 per 1 million input tokens and $15 per million output tokens.

Tokens are chunks of words, characters, or even phrases that are assigned a code while training a model. They're not limited to text alone and can take various data forms. They help AI models understand 'human language', to help formulate the appropriate response.

Notably, incidents of hallucination, the phenomenon where an AI model will pass off false information as true, are much lesser in o1-preview, compared to previous models. But they're not gone completely, "We can't say we solved hallucinations," OpenAI's Research Lead Jerry Tworek told The Verge.
